Annual Habitat For Humanity 5K Coming To Bridgeport

BRIDGEPORT, Conn. -- Habitat for Humanity of Coastal Fairfield County invites local residents to join in a 5K run and walk on Saturday, Oct. 8 in Bridgeport.

Habitat for Humanity of Coastal Fairfield County will hold its 19th Annual 5K Run for Home and Work Boot Challenge on Saturday, Oct. 8.

The 19th Annual 5K Run for Home and WorkBoot Challenge takes place at Seaside Park. 

Registration and stretching begins at 7:30 a.m., with the race and workboot challenge at 9 a.m. The kids relay race starts at 10 a.m. 

The 5k Race is computer timed and awards will be given to the male and female champions as well as the top three male and female runners in various age groups.

Free food and beer follows the ceremony.

For the first time this year, runners can opt into the WorkBoot Challenge by running or walking in work boots alongside those in sneakers. 

Online registration is currently open for the event which will help local families obtain affordable housing in conjunction with Habitat for Humanity CFC. 

The price of entry is $25 for those who register prior to the race and $30 the day of the race. Children 12 years old and under are free for both the main event and kids' relay.
